Transaction 649fb5c357a2bc2923aaeb8193bd0caf32e8b64a9ba6c2ed87824cb41461dbd0
1 Input
1 Outputs
- 649fb5c357a2bc2923aaeb8193bd0caf32e8b64a9ba6c2ed87824cb41461dbd0:0
value 6245706
address 15MSvFrVz9r4LtEn3FTSdri6KBKMgGEXqS